Ultrasonic / level sensors measure the distance to the target by measuring the time between the emission and reception. Ultrasonic sensors use ultrasonic waves for things like detecting the distance to an object, detecting the presence or absence of objects, and detecting the movement of objects. These sensors use a transducer to send and get ultrasonic sound waves or pulses that transfer back data about an object’s vicinity.
How Do Ultrasonic Sensors Work?
These sensors use a transducer to send and get ultrasonic sound waves or pulses that transfer back data about an object’s vicinity. The sensor head emits an ultrasonic wave and receives the wave reflected back from the target. Ultrasonic / level sensors measure the distance to the target by measuring the time between the emission and reception.
